[. . . ] Default setting: Not selected Account Number When "Auditing mode" is enabled in the key operator programs, a count is kept of the number of pages printed by each account. Enter your account number for printing that was established in the key operator programs. If a limit for the number of pages that your account can print is set in the key operator programs, printing will not be possible after the limit is reached. If "Prohibit notice page printing" is disabled in the key operator programs, a Notice Page will be printed. (The Notice Page is initially set to not print out. ) If "Cancel jobs of invalid accounts" is enabled in the key operator programs and an incorrect account number or no account number is entered, printing will not take place. If you do not wish to restrict use of the machine, disable the setting. Menu frame Click a setting in the menu to configure it. 1 System Information This is used to view system information, the status of the devices, the device configuration, and the network status. This page is view-only; names and locations cannot be changed in the page. I Device Status Shows the current status of the machine, paper trays, output trays, toner and other supplies, and page counts. Out of paper and other warnings appear in red. I Device Configuration Shows what options are installed. This includes optional paper sources, optional output devices, hardware options, memory, and software options. I Network Status Shows the network status.
